Iraqi Justice Ministry spokesman Busho Ibrahim said Oras Muhammad Abdul-Aziz was executed by hanging. In 2006, Iraq's Central Criminal Court sentenced Abdul-Aziz to death for his role in the bombing of the Imam Ali shrine in Al-Najaf. The blast killed at least 85 people, including the then head of the Supreme Council for the Islamic Revolution in Iraq. Iraq is now the world's fourth highest user of the death penalty, Amnesty International reported. Only China, Iran and Pakistan used the death penalty more frequently.
